Sandur Manganese & Iron Ores Ltd Price to Earnings Ratio Current Value

The current Sandur Manganese & Iron Ores Ltd Price to Earnings Ratio stands at 15.16.

The Sandur Manganese & Iron Ores Ltd Price to Earnings Ratio has declined compared to earlier levels, suggesting improved fundamentals or more attractive valuation.

Sandur Manganese & Iron Ores Ltd Price to Earnings Ratio Historical Trend

The Sandur Manganese & Iron Ores Ltd Price to Earnings Ratio has shown the following historical trend:

  • 2024: 15.16
  • 2023: 24.52
  • 2022: 10.25
  • 2021: 4.70
  • 2020: 5.92

The decline in Sandur Manganese & Iron Ores Ltd Price to Earnings Ratio indicates improving financial efficiency or better earnings growth.
